Let's see, the first clip is from "Foiled Again" (when the gang is playing "Liar's Poker" on the beach at the KKC). The second clip is from "From Moscow to Maui". The third clip is from "The Last Page" (at the "Zebra Club" (?)). The fourth clip is from "The Elmo Ziller Story". The fifth clip is from "Almost Home". And the last one is from "Mixed Doubles".
